Output d38679626932dab153b75f987706f317d31ad076af15a9ff9b8700c36cc46448:8

value
2513000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45184e727fdb9f497d12915c5c7ea0addad9c323 OP_EQUAL
address
37zMfcxR37E8tiABaoFxtgpTyGpSjxA5Q3
transaction
d38679626932dab153b75f987706f317d31ad076af15a9ff9b8700c36cc46448
spent
true